Specialized Knowledge and Expertise

Pediatric ENT specialists are trained specifically to handle ear-related conditions in children. They possess a deep understanding of the anatomical and physiological differences between children and adults, which allows them to offer precise diagnoses and tailored treatments. Conditions such as otitis media (middle ear infections), hearing loss, and allergies can vary significantly in children, necessitating specialized care.

Comprehensive Evaluation

A pediatric ENT can perform a thorough evaluation to determine the root cause of ear-related issues. This often includes a physical examination, hearing tests, and imaging studies if necessary. Early diagnosis is crucial, as untreated ear problems can lead to long-term complications such as speech delays or poor academic performance.

Effective Treatment Options

Pediatric ENT care offers a range of treatment options suitable for children's developmental needs. From medication to manage infections to safe surgical procedures, specialized ENT doctors ensure that interventions are less invasive and tailored to minimize discomfort for young patients. For example, tympanostomy tubes may be recommended for children with recurrent ear infections, helping to prevent future complications and improve hearing.
